--- /dev/null Thu Jan 01 00:00:00 1970 +0000 +++ b/xml/en/docs/howto_setup_development_environment_on_ec2.xml Thu Feb 02 09:28:47 2012 +0000 @@ -0,0 +1,71 @@ +<?xml version="1.0"?> + +<!DOCTYPE article SYSTEM "../../../dtd/article.dtd"> + +<article name="Setting up development environment with nginx on Amazon EC2" + link="/en/docs/howto_setup_development_environment_on_ec2.html" + lang="en"> + +<section> + +<para> +As an ISV participating in AWS Solution Providers Program, nginx is +offering an automated install script for use with AWS EC2 instances. +This helper script is targeted at the developers who have just +started using nginx and EC2, and who would like to get things up quickly +and efficiently. Please check the action list below in order to +prepare your virtual machine and nginx configuration. +</para> + +<para> +To setup a development environment: +<list> +<item> +Follow the +<link url="http://docs.amazonwebservices.com/AWSEC2/latest/GettingStartedGuide/Welcome.html"> +Get Started with EC2</link> guide to sign up to AWS and +launch your EC2 instance. Only Amazon Linux is supported, so please +choose either "Basic 32-bit Amazon Linux AMI" or +"Basic 64-bit Amazon Linux AMI" for an AMI. When configuring +the firewall rules it is necessary to add a rule to accept web +traffic on port 80. +</item> + +<item> +As soon as the new instance is launched, log in to it and +download <literal>aws_nginx_setup.sh</literal> script with the +following command: +<programlisting> +wget http://nginx.org/download/aws_nginx_setup.sh +</programlisting> +then run the script with root privileges: +<programlisting> +sudo sh ./aws_nginx_setup.sh +</programlisting> +</item> + +<item> +You will be asked to select what components to install. Currently +it is possible to choose Django, Pyramid, Ruby on Rails or PHP +development environment. After you have selected the necessary +component the script will automatically prepare its configuration +for use with nginx. There will be a separate user created too, +and then a sample web application is started to ensure everything +is working correctly. +</item> + +<item> +After the installation completes and the web application is installed +in a subdirectory inside /var/www, the script will print how to +start/stop sample application. For example, the Rails application will +reside in /var/www/rails, and Rails specific part of nginx configuration +will be in /etc/nginx/conf.d/rails.conf. +Installed application and configs can be used as a basis for +futher development. +</item> +</list> +</para> + +</section> + +</article>
